发明名称 Method for manufacturing colorless transparent glass-fabric reinforced polyimide film for flexible displays
摘要 A method of manufacturing a colorless transparent polyimide film having reinforced glass fabric for flexible displays, suitable for use in increasing optical transmittance of a polyimide substrate having reinforced glass fabric for flexible displays. This method enables the glass fabric and the colorless transparent polyimide film to be matched in refractive index when the glass fabric is reinforced in the colorless transparent polyimide film to enhance thermal and mechanical properties of a substrate for flexible displays, thus satisfying high optical transparency and optical transmittance of 85% or more, required of a substrate for flexible displays, and thereby the colorless transparent polyimide film having reinforced glass fabric can be used as a substrate for flexible displays.

主权项 1. A method of manufacturing a colorless transparent polyimide film with glass fabric reinforced, comprising: (1) preparing a polyamic acid solution; (2) positioning glass fabric on a substrate, and casting the polyamic acid solution on the glass fabric in a vacuum oven; (3) evaporating a solvent from the cast polyamic acid solution by controlling temperature of the vacuum oven to form a polyamic acid film on the substrate; and (4) subjecting the polyamic acid film to imidization through thermal curing, wherein the polyamic acid solution is a polyamic acid solution (C) prepared by mixing polyamic acid solution (A) with higher refractive index and polyamic acid solution (B) with lower refractive index than that of the glass fabric, upon forming the polyimide film.
